Gaudavaho is an epic narrative detailing the conquest of Gauda and the legendary expeditions of King Yashovarman of Kanauj.
Composed in the classical Prakrit language, this masterpiece serves as a vivid historical record of 8th-century Indian politics, society, and nature.
Blending themes of heroism, divinity, and folk culture, it remains an invaluable treasure of ancient Indian literary heritage.
